Newcastle Excellence Scholarships

Who is the award for?

The awards are aimed at talented, first year, UK undergraduate students commencing study in September 2012.

Award Amount

£500 per grade A achieved in BIOLOGY, CHEMISTRY, MATHS or PHYSICS at A level (or equivalent qualifications) up to a maximum of £1,500. This sum is awarded one time only.

Eligibility Criteria

In order to be eligible for the award you must:

  • Make the School of Biology Degree programme your FIRM choice (UF or CF) through UCAS
  • Exceed the grades specified in your conditional offer
  • Meet or exceed grades specified for individual subjects
  • Be a UK or EU student
How to Apply

You do not need to apply for these awards as you will be considered automatically upon receiving your examination results. You will be contacted by the school if you have met all of the criteria.

When will the award be paid?

Half the award will be paid early in year 1 and the second at the start of year 2 as long as a 70% average is achieved in year 1 assessments.

In addition, one bursary of £500 will be awarded to the highest achieving applicant from the University's PARTNERS programme for widening participation in higher education.
